Troubleshooting

This section provides information to help you diagnose and solve various problems that may arise while
configuring or using your GE Security product.
• The bus LED is not flashing.
Turn off panel AC power and verify that all wiring is correct.
Note: All buffered messages may be received from the two-way paging network upon restoring power to the module.
• The module status LEDs do not immediately turn on after initial power-up.
You may have to wait five to eight minutes for the module to communicate with Alarm.com services.
• The touchpads/sirens are beeping even though the system is not armed.
Press *, 2 to display the trouble condition. Refer to your touchpad documentation for details.
NetworX panels
9.5 to 15 VDC, 12 V nominal, 65 mA (continuous), 1600 mA (instantaneous peak),
maximum from panel or auxiliary power supply
Quad Band GSM/GPRS
One 3-wire NetworX power/communication data bus
One module/panel communication status LED. Four wireless communication status
LEDs
32 to 120°F (0 to 49°C)
-30 to 140°F (-34 to 60°C)
90% relative humidity, noncondensing
Belgian gray
High impact, ABS plastic
5.25 x 4.125 x 1.0 in. (13.3 x 10.5 x 2.5 cm)
Wall mount
